BIOTECHNOLOGICAL VALORIZATION OF THE BIOMASS FROM THE BANANA PLANT FOR THE SUSTAINABLE PRODUCTION OF LACTIC ACID

BANANA IS ONE OF THE MAIN AGRICULTURAL PRODUCTS OF ECUADOR, WITH A CULTIVATED AREA OF APPROXIMATELY 160.6 THOUSAND HECTARES AND AN ANNUAL PRODUCTION NEARLY 6.0 MILLION TONS. HOWEVER, INTENSIVE PRODUCTION GENERATES ABOUT 5 MILLION TONS OF RESIDUAL BIOMASS EACH YEAR (PSEUDOTOM, LEAVES, RACHIS AND NON-MARKETABLE FRUITS). A LARGE PART OF THIS BIOMASS IS LEFT IN THE SOIL, WHICH PROMOTES THE PROLIFERATION OF PESTS, GENERATES GREENHOUSE GASES AND CAN CAUSE LEACHING OF NUTRIENTS INTO GROUNDWATER. THIS PROJECT PROPOSES THE VALORIZATION OF THIS BIOMASS BY OBTAINING FERMENTABLE SUGARS FROM ENZYMATIC HYDROLYSIS AND PHYSICAL PRETREATMENTS, COMPARING THEIR EFFICIENCY TO RELEASE GLUCOSE. SUBSEQUENTLY, THE SUGARS WILL BE FERMENTED FOR THE SUSTAINABLE PRODUCTION OF LACTIC ACID, A COMPOUND OF HIGH INDUSTRIAL VALUE USED IN BIOPLASTICS, FOOD AND PHARMACEUTICALS. OPERATING CONDITIONS WILL BE OPTIMIZED THROUGH FACTORIAL DESIGN AND TAGUCHI DESIGN TO MAXIMIZE THE PERFORMANCE OF LACTIC ACID. THIS PROJECT SEEKS TO CONVERT AN ENVIRONMENTAL PROBLEM INTO AN OPPORTUNITY FOR ECONOMIC AND TECHNOLOGICAL DEVELOPMENT.
